Safety Precautions: Essential Tips for Travelers in the dominican Republic
When traveling to the Dominican Republic, it’s vital to prioritize your safety to ensure a pleasant and secure experience. Stay informed about local news and travel advisories, as these can provide crucial information about areas to avoid or special precautions you should take. Always make sure to keep your personal belongings secure and avoid displaying valuables openly. In unfamiliar places, trust your instincts; if a situation feels uncomfortable, seek out a public area or reach out to locals for assistance.
Engaging in outdoor activities can be one of the highlights of your trip, but it’s essential to follow safety protocols. Consider these tips for a safer adventure:
- Travel in groups: Explore with friends or fellow travelers, especially at night.
- Use reputable transportation: Opt for licensed taxis or rideshare services instead of hailing a car off the street.
- Stay connected: Keep your phone charged and share your location with someone you trust.
- Register with local authorities: If you’re an extended visitor, consider letting your embassy know about your stay.
